Senior living facilities handle some of the most hygiene-sensitive laundry in any commercial setting: incontinence-related soiling, wound-care linens, and personal clothing belonging to cognitively impaired residents who cannot advocate for their own comfort. Infection control is critical in environments where immunocompromised residents share common spaces. Choosing the right commercial laundry provider directly affects your CMS star rating, your survey results, and your residents' dignity.

Local Considerations in New York, NY

In humid climates, incontinence-soiled linens generate ammonia gas and bacterial growth much faster than in dry climates — even a few hours in a closed hamper creates a serious contamination risk. Look for providers who can offer daily or near-daily pickup frequency in high-humidity markets, and confirm they use a chlorine-based or high-temperature sanitization protocol that eliminates pathogens rather than simply masking odor. Prompt removal of soiled items protects both resident dignity and staff health.

Common Challenges for Senior Living & Care Facilities in New York, NY

  • ! High incidence of incontinence-soiled linens that require specialized bio-soil treatment to fully sanitize and deodorize
  • ! Risk of cross-contamination in facilities housing residents with Clostridioides difficile (C. diff) or other highly transmissible infections
  • ! Resident personal clothing lost or damaged in facility laundry, leading to family complaints and regulatory flags
  • ! Staff burnout from handling sensitive laundry tasks alongside direct care responsibilities

Compliance & Regulatory Context

The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) conditions of participation for skilled nursing facilities include laundry sanitation standards as part of the environment of care requirements. State long-term care licensing agencies conduct annual surveys that include linen and laundry sanitation reviews. Facilities found deficient in linen hygiene can receive citations that affect their CMS star rating — a direct impact on census and revenue. C. diff-contaminated linens require specific handling protocols including hot-water washing (above 160°F) or chemical disinfection with bleach-based systems.

Why Professional Laundering?

The combination of bio-soil complexity, infection control requirements, and the emotional sensitivity around resident personal items makes in-house laundry management a significant operational and liability burden. Healthcare-certified commercial laundry providers bring specialized bio-soil processing, resident-item tracking by name label, and documented sanitation records that protect the facility during CMS surveys.

Frequently Asked Questions — Senior Living & Care Facilities Laundry in New York, NY

How does a commercial laundry keep resident personal clothing from being mixed up or lost?
Reputable providers serving senior care facilities use resident-specific tagging systems — typically sewn-in or iron-on name labels scanned at intake and matched at return. Items are processed in mesh bags assigned per resident and returned sorted by resident name, ready for distribution by care staff.
How should heavily soiled incontinence linens be stored before pickup?
Double-bag soiled incontinence items in sealed plastic bags at the point of use. Do not allow them to accumulate in open hampers for more than 24 hours, as ammonia and bacteria buildup accelerates. Your commercial provider should supply appropriate containment bags and schedule pickup frequency based on your facility's soiling volume.
What is the protocol if a resident has a confirmed C. diff infection?
Notify your laundry provider immediately. C. diff spores are resistant to standard detergents and require either high-temperature washing (above 160°F) or a chlorine bleach-based laundry protocol. Items from confirmed C. diff residents should be bagged separately and clearly marked. A certified healthcare laundry will have a documented C. diff protocol in their service agreement.
